Grounds For Sculpture

80 Sculptors Way, Hamilton Township, NJ 08619
, (609) 586-0616

Grounds For Sculpture is a 42-acre sculpture park and museum located in Hamilton, New Jersey on the former site of the Trenton Speedway. GFS maintains a collection of over 270 contemporary sculptures, many of them large-scale, with works by Johnson and other American and international artists. In addition to the sculptures exhibited in landscaped environments, there are also six indoor art galleries

Historic Walnford

62 Walnford Road, Allentown, NJ 08501
, (609) 259-6275

At the heart of the Crosswicks Creek Park, the site showcases over 200 years of social, technological and environmental history through the Waln family. The historic district includes 36 acres of field, woodland and wetlands. Visit the large, elegant home built in 1773, the 19th century gristmill and the farm buildings set in a beautiful landscape. The site is open 8 a.m.-4:30 p.m. daily

Plainsboro Preserve

80 Scotts Corner Road, Cranbury, NJ 08512
, (609) 799-4013

The preserved 1,000 acres support a diversity of habitats and wildlife, with one of the largest lakes in the area. The Rush Holt Environmental Center houses program space, a variety of exhibits, live animals and a reference library. Enjoy over five miles of trails meandering through mature beech woods, wet meadows, and the shoreline of scenic 50-acre McCormack Lake.
